Customer

Our customer was AVS Services offering video surveillance services and doing business with retailers and companies in the catering industry.

Background

AVS Services clients want to continuously monitor the availability of goods in display cases, since they provide cooked food products and it is essential for them that the shelves are stocked throughout the working hours. Employees of cafes and retail outlets should ensure such availability. But employees need to serve customers, and there is no time left for checking missing items and replenishing display cabinets.

Business Challenge

AVS Services decided to offer its clients a solution to their problem — automatically identify out-of-stocks and analyze how empty spaces are stocked during the day. This will help determine fluctuations in demand and more accurately plan the workload of employees and amounts of products for cooking and/or purchase.

Solution

Usually Goods Checker is trained to recognise all SKUs, and only to identify the missing products.

This case was different, since the products were varying in every shelf and would usually be changed during the day, thus the traditional approach didn’t work. So we used a segmentation system that enabled Goods Checker to anonymously recognize all objects in a photo. In other words this allowed detecting gaps without even knowing what products are on the shelves.

All the data was processed and combined in dashboards for the management of the client to review. In addition, we developed a Messenger bot (WhatsApp, Telegram) that automatically sends notifications to cafe employees when a gap in a certain product category is detected.

The solution is deployed in IBA Group’s secure data center in Prague, Czech Republic. Goods Checker is GDPR compliant.

Result

With this project, AVS Services offered clients a solution to their problem – constant monitoring of fullness of shelves and employees’ work. Goods Checker helped determine when shelves are most often empty of goods, including their categories.

Other beneficiaries are the AVS clients’ employees, since now they receive the notifications about empty spaces on the shelves automatically.

When fully implemented, Goods Checker will help AVS Services clients ensure product availability on display and improve sales, and also adjust the amount of products on shelves in accordance with demand and significantly reduce the number of spoiled food.

The Goods Checker solution is now being prepared for scaling and commercial operation.
